Beta Reading & Proofreading — Plain-Language Terms
This page outlines the terms that apply to every project booked with The Author's Back Office — whether directly by email or through Fiverr/PeoplePerHour. Booking a project or paying an invoice means you've read and agree to these terms.
You'll receive the specific service you booked — beta reading, proofreading, or both — with scope, word-count tier, and turnaround confirmed by email before any work begins.
Manuscripts within 10% of a tier's word count are accepted at that tier's rate, no extra charge. If your manuscript runs longer than that, you'll be notified before work starts whether it fits the next tier or needs a custom quote. No surprise charges, ever.
Feedback and/or your line-edited manuscript will be delivered by the confirmed timeline. If any part of the feedback is unclear, you can request a follow-up clarification at no extra charge. This doesn't include a second full read-through or re-edit beyond the original scope.
Your manuscript stays private. It will never be shared, published, or distributed without your written permission. A copy may be kept on file briefly for record-keeping purposes only.
You keep full ownership and copyright of your work, always. Nothing about this agreement transfers any rights to the Editor. Feedback, tracked changes, and style sheets are deliverables that become yours to use however you'd like.
Cancel before work begins, and you'll receive a full refund. If work has already started, a prorated refund applies based on the portion completed.
Feedback is provided in good faith, based on professional judgment. The Editor isn't responsible for your publishing decisions, sales outcomes, or reviews of your published work. Liability under this agreement is limited to the amount you paid for the service in question.
